Business Context and Reporting Period
Company: Southwest Airlines Co.
Filing Type: Form 8-K (Current Report)
Date of Report: May 19, 2026
Event: Entry into a Material Definitive Agreement and Creation of a Direct Financial Obligation.
Key Financial Metrics and Debt Structure
This filing details a specific debt financing transaction rather than general operating performance. Key metrics include:
- Original Term Loan Facility: $500 million principal (established March 11, 2026).
- New Incremental Term Loans: $1.0 billion principal added via the Increase Joinder.
- Total Outstanding Principal: $1.5 billion as of May 19, 2026.
- Maturity Date: March 11, 2029.
- Prepayment Terms: Permitted in whole or in part without premium or penalty upon three business days' notice.
- Collateral: Secured by a security interest in certain aircraft and related assets, subject to a minimum collateral coverage ratio.

Material Changes Versus Prior Period
The primary material change is the expansion of the Company's senior secured term loan credit facility:
- Debt Increase: The aggregate principal amount of term loans increased from $500 million to $1.5 billion.
- Future Capacity: The agreement amends the uncommitted incremental term loan feature to allow for up to an additional $1.0 billion in incremental term loan commitments to be established in the future.
- Collateral Pool: The collateral pool was expanded to include additional aircraft and related assets to support the increased borrowing.
Outlook, Risks, and Contingencies
Management Commentary: The filing confirms the terms of the First Incremental Term Loans are substantially the same as existing Term Loans regarding interest rates, covenants, and events of default.
Risks and Contingencies:
- Acceleration Risk: Amounts outstanding may be accelerated upon the occurrence of an event of default.
- Covenant Compliance: The Company must maintain a minimum collateral coverage ratio to supplement, replace, or remove assets from the collateral pool or request lien releases.
- Reborrowing Restriction: Amounts prepaid under the Amended Credit Agreement may not be reborrowed.
